People come from miles around to sample the outstanding breakfasts at this modest restaurant. The muffins and scones emerge fresh from the oven, and entrees such as the breakfast burrito or strawberry mascarpone-cheese pancakes call for a hearty appetite. You can start in again in the evening, on well-priced Pacific Rim and/or neo-Italian fare, such as penne prosciutto sautéed with garlic, black pepper, and a splash of vodka. Main courses include local seafood and lobster dishes, like lobster risotto with asparagus and saffron. There's even a creative children's menu here.
